**Vendor note: Inkmill markdown pipeline**

Rendering for Parchway docs is outsourced to Inkmill under an annual contract, renewing each March. They handle sanitization and PDF export; we own the upload queue. SLA: 4-hour response on rendering failures. Escalate only after two failed retries. Their support desk is reachable at the address below.

billing contact of hahaf-baguf = zorael.tammir.jorius@sivrelhq.internal

/*
 * Client setup for the Gridling crossword generator's dictionary service.
 * Release managers: this client fetches curated word lists from the Fennwick
 * lexicon API during the nightly puzzle build. Rate limits are strict, so do
 * not parallelize builds beyond four workers. The credential is rotated each
 * release cycle and must match the value in the release checklist. The current
 * key for the Fennwick lexicon API is set directly below.
 */

API key for yahig-tadup: kto7_ubizbYm

A: Tariffon evaluates fee rules authored in the Hollis admin console; rules are signed at publish time and verified before execution, so tampering with stored rules fails closed. Rule authors are limited to a sandboxed expression language with no network or filesystem access, and every evaluation is logged with the rule version and author. Audit exports are retained for eighteen months. For the current threat model document or pen-test reports, contact the platform security team at the address below.

escalation mailbox, yajeg-bageg: quenax.olidor@lumiccorp.internal